  • Publication number: 20070124106
    Abstract: The invention relates to a method for determining the position (x, y) of at least one point of reflection (R1-2) on an obstacle (200). According to traditional methods of this kind a first distance (r1) between the point of reflection (R1-2) and a first position (x1) of a distance measuring device is calculated by evaluating a time period between the emission of a transmission signal and reception of a reflection signal. In order to state the unsharp position of the point of reflection thereby obtained even more precisely, in addition to the first distance (r1), a second distance (r2) of the point of reflection is calculated with respect to a second position (x2) of the distance measuring device in analogy to the calculation of the first distance (r1) and then a defined position (x, y) is calculated from the pair of variates (x1, r1) (x2, r2) so obtained using the triangulation method.

  • Patent number: 7205905
    Abstract: The invention relates to a method for operating a parking assistance system for a vehicle, comprising at least one distance sensor that detects at least sections of the lateral immediate vicinity of the vehicle and at least one path sensor that detects the path travelled by the vehicle. According to the method, a control device determines the length and/or width of a parking space from the values measured by the sensors as the vehicle drives past said parking space. The invention is characterised in that the measured length and/or width of the parking space is/are corrected by a correction value and/or that depending on the speed of the vehicle as it drives past the parking space, the measurement is taken by means of the distance sensor at different time intervals.

  • Publication number: 20070030347
    Abstract: The invention relates to a method for detecting the contour of an obstacle in the surroundings of a moving vehicle by means of a sensor device that is preferably integrated in the lateral area of the vehicle. In previously known methods of this type, the sensor device usually emits a sensor signal to the obstacle already when said obstacle lies ahead in the direction of travel while also emitting a sensor signal once the vehicle has passed the obstacle. In order to improve evaluation of the sensor signals with regard to the reflection thereof on the obstacle, the reflection signals thus generated are first mathematically averaged so as to be able to then derive in a more precise manner the actual position and the actual shape of the contour of the obstacle from the obtained averaged reflection signal.

  • Publication number: 20060256227
    Abstract: The invention relates to a digital camera device for identifying an object, and to a method and a computer program for producing the same. According to prior art, digital camera devices comprising an objective, a light sensor and an image producing device are known. It is also known that the recorded images have a distortion effect that depends on the focal length of the objective, said distortion effect until now being corrected by calculation in the image producing device during processing of the image. The claim of the invention is to render one such calculated correction superfluous. Towards this end, the density of pixel elements is determined according to the focal length of the objective for the flat arrangement of said pixel elements in the light sensor device.

  • Patent number: 6906640
    Abstract: A method for operating a parking assistance system and a parking assistance system for a vehicle, is characterized by the following steps: a) determination of the length and/or width of a parking space when passing the parking space; b) determination of at least one feasible parking process for the vehicle for entering into or exiting the parking space; c) instructing the driver as to which direction the vehicle shall be moved and how far the steering wheel must be turned, and d) automatic braking and/or acceleration of the vehicle during the parking process into or out of a parking space, wherein steps c) and d) can be effected in any order, one after the other and/or at the same time.
